RE: PARKS SIIALLOW LAND DISPOSAL AREA (SLDA)

This is to advise you that BWXT and ARCO are still pursuing a response to your letter of September 3,1998 concerningjustification for submittal of a decommissioning plan beyond the 12-month timeframe required by 10CFR70.38. A response to your September 3 letter will be provided on or before October 20,1998.
